     PHARSIGHT CORPORATION, a Delaware corporation (the "COMPANY"), proposes to
issue and sell ____________ shares of its Common Stock, $0.001 par value (the
"FIRM SHARES"), to the several underwriters named in Schedule I hereto (the
"UNDERWRITERS").   The Company also proposes to issue and sell to the several
Underwriters not more than an additional _______ shares of its Common Stock,
$0.001 par value (the "ADDITIONAL SHARES"), if requested by the Underwriters as
provided in Section 2 hereof.   The Firm Shares and the Additional Shares are
hereinafter referred to collectively as the "SHARES". The shares of common stock
of the Company to be outstanding after giving effect to the sales contemplated
hereby are hereinafter referred to as the "COMMON STOCK".

     SECTION 2.     Agreements to Sell and Purchase and Lock-Up Agreements.  On
the basis of the representations and warranties contained in this Agreement, and
subject to its terms and conditions, the Company agrees to issue and sell, and
each Underwriter agrees, severally and not jointly, to purchase from the Company
at a price per Share of $______ (the "PURCHASE PRICE") the number of Firm Shares
set forth opposite the name of such Underwriter in Schedule I hereto.

     On the basis of the representations and warranties contained in this
Agreement, and subject to its terms and conditions, the Company agrees to issue
and sell the Additional Shares and the Underwriters shall have the right to
purchase, severally and not jointly, up to an aggregate of _______ Additional
Shares from the Company at the Purchase Price.   Additional Shares may be
purchased solely for the purpose of covering over-allotments made in connection
with the offering of the Firm Shares.   The Underwriters may exercise their
right to purchase Additional Shares in whole or in part from time to time by
giving written notice thereof to the Company within 30 days after the date of
this Agreement.  You shall give any such notice on behalf of the Underwriters
and such notice shall specify the aggregate number of Additional Shares to be
purchased pursuant to such exercise and the date for payment and delivery
thereof, which date shall be a business day (i) no earlier than two business
days after such notice has been given (and, in any event, no earlier than the
Closing Date (as hereinafter defined)) and (ii) no later than ten business days
after such notice has been given.   If any Additional Shares are to be
purchased, each Underwriter, severally and not jointly, agrees to purchase from
the Company the number of Additional Shares (subject to such adjustments to
eliminate fractional shares as you may determine) which bears the same
proportion to the total number of Additional Shares to be purchased from the
Company as the number of Firm

                                          2
<PAGE>

Shares set forth opposite the name of such Underwriter in Schedule I bears to
the total number of Firm Shares.

     The Company hereby agrees not to (i) offer, pledge, sell, contract to sell,
sell any option or contract to purchase, purchase any option or contract to
sell, grant any option, right or warrant to purchase, or otherwise transfer or
dispose of, directly or indirectly, any shares of Common Stock or any securities
convertible into or exercisable or exchangeable for Common Stock or (ii) enter
into any swap or other arrangement that transfers all or a portion of the
economic consequences associated with the ownership of any Common Stock
(regardless of whether any of the transactions described in clause (i) or (ii)
is to be settled by the delivery of Common Stock, or such other securities, in
cash or otherwise), except to the Underwriters pursuant to this Agreement, for a
period of 180 days after the date of the Prospectus without the prior written
consent of Donaldson, Lufkin & Jenrette Securities Corporation. Notwithstanding
the foregoing, during such  period (i) the Company may grant stock options and
issue stock pursuant to the Company's existing stock option and employee stock
purchase plans and (ii) the Company may issue shares of Common Stock upon the
exercise of an option or warrant or the conversion of a security outstanding on
the date hereof.  The Company also agrees not to file any registration
statement, other than on Form S-8, with respect to any shares of Common Stock or
any securities convertible into or exercisable or exchangeable for Common Stock
for a period of 180 days after the date of the Prospectus without the prior
written consent of Donaldson, Lufkin & Jenrette Securities Corporation.  The
Company shall, prior to or concurrently with the execution of this Agreement,
deliver an agreement executed by (i) each of the directors and officers of the
Company and (ii) each stockholder listed on Annex I hereto to the effect that
such person will not, during the period commencing on the date such person signs
such agreement and ending 180 days after the date of the Prospectus, or any
earlier date that is permitted by the terms of such agreement, without the prior
written consent of Donaldson, Lufkin & Jenrette Securities Corporation, (A)
engage in any of the transactions described in the first sentence of this
paragraph or (B) make any demand for, or exercise any right with respect to, the
registration of any shares of Common Stock or any securities convertible into or
exercisable or exchangeable for Common Stock..

     The Company hereby confirms its engagement of , Chase Securities Inc.
("CHASE H&Q") as, and Chase H&Q hereby confirms its agreement with the Company
to render services as, a "qualified independent underwriter" within the meaning
of Section (b)(15) of Rule 2720 of the National Association of Securities
Dealers, Inc. with respect to the offering and sale of the Shares.  Chase H&Q,
solely in its capacity as the qualified independent underwriter and not
otherwise, is referred to herein as the "QIU".  As compensation for the services
of the QIU hereunder, the Company agrees to pay the QIU $5,000 on the Closing
Date.  The price at which the Shares will be sold to the public shall not be
higher than the maximum price recommended by the QIU.

     (e)  To the extent the indemnification provided for in this Section 7 is
unavailable to an indemnified party or insufficient in respect of any losses,
claims, damages, liabilities or judgments referred to therein, then each
indemnifying party, in lieu of indemnifying such indemnified party, shall
contribute to the amount paid or payable by such indemnified party as a result
of such losses, claims, damages, liabilities and judgments (i) in such
proportion as is appropriate to reflect the relative benefits received by the
Company on the one hand and the Underwriters on the other hand from the offering
of the Shares or (ii) if the allocation provided by clause 7(e)(i) above is not
permitted by applicable law, in such proportion as is appropriate to reflect not
only the relative benefits referred to in clause 7(e)(i) above but also the
relative fault of the Company on the one hand and the Underwriters on the other
hand in connection with the statements or

                                          17
<PAGE>

omissions which resulted in such losses, claims, damages, liabilities or
judgments, as well as any other relevant equitable considerations.  The relative
benefits received by the Company on the one hand and the Underwriters on the
other hand shall be deemed to be in the same proportion as the total net
proceeds from the offering (after deducting underwriting discounts and
commissions, but before deducting expenses) received by the Company, and the
total underwriting discounts and commissions received by the Underwriters, bear
to the total price to the public of the Shares, in each case as set forth in the
table on the cover page of the Prospectus.  The relative fault of the Company on
the one hand and the Underwriters on the other hand shall be determined by
reference to, among other things, whether the untrue or alleged untrue statement
of a material fact or the omission or alleged omission to state a material fact
relates to information supplied by the Company or the Underwriters and the
parties' relative intent, knowledge, access to information and opportunity to
correct or prevent such statement or omission.

     The Company and the Underwriters agree that it would not be just and
equitable if contribution pursuant to this Section 7(e) were determined by pro
rata allocation (even if the Underwriters were treated as one entity for such
purpose) or by any other method of allocation which does not take account of the
equitable considerations referred to in the immediately preceding paragraph.
The amount paid or payable by an indemnified party as a result of the losses,
claims, damages, liabilities or judgments referred to in the immediately
preceding paragraph shall be deemed to include, subject to the limitations set
forth above, any legal or other expenses incurred by such indemnified party in
connection with investigating or defending any matter, including any action,
that could have given rise to such losses, claims, damages, liabilities or
judgments.  Notwithstanding the provisions of this Section 7, no Underwriter
shall be required to contribute any amount in excess of the amount by which the
total price at which the Shares underwritten by it and distributed to the public
were offered to the public exceeds the amount of any damages which such
Underwriter has otherwise been required to pay by reason of such untrue or
alleged untrue statement or omission or alleged omission.  No person guilty of
fraudulent misrepresentation (within the meaning of Section 11(f) of the Act)
shall be entitled to contribution from any person who was not guilty of such
fraudulent misrepresentation.  The Underwriters' obligations to contribute
pursuant to this Section 7(e) are several in proportion to the respective number
of Shares purchased by each of the Underwriters hereunder and not joint.

     SECTION 10.  Effectiveness of Agreement and Termination.  This Agreement
shall become effective upon the execution and delivery of this Agreement by the
parties hereto.

     This Agreement may be terminated at any time on or prior to the Closing
Date by you by written notice to the Company if any of the following has
occurred:  (i) any outbreak or escalation of hostilities or other national or
international calamity or crisis or change in economic conditions or in the
financial markets of the United States or elsewhere that, in your judgment, is
material and adverse and, in your judgment, makes it impracticable to market the
Shares on the terms and in the manner contemplated in the Prospectus, (ii) the
suspension or material limitation of trading in securities or other instruments
on the New York Stock Exchange, the American Stock Exchange, the Chicago Board
of Options Exchange, the Chicago Mercantile Exchange, the Chicago Board of Trade
or the Nasdaq National Market or limitation on prices for securities or other
instruments on any such exchange or the Nasdaq National Market, (iii) the
suspension of trading of any securities of the Company on any exchange or in the
over-the-counter market, (iv) the enactment, publication, decree or other
promulgation of any federal or state statute, regulation, rule or order of any
court or other governmental authority which in your opinion materially and
adversely affects, or will materially and adversely affect, the business,
prospects, financial condition or results of operations of the Company, (v) the
declaration of a banking moratorium by either federal or New York State
authorities or (vi) the taking of any action by any federal, state or local
government or agency in respect of its monetary or fiscal affairs which in your
opinion has a material adverse effect on the financial markets in the United
States.

     If on the Closing Date or on an Option Closing Date, as the case may be,
any one or more of the Underwriters shall fail or refuse to purchase the Firm
Shares or Additional Shares, as the case may be, which it has or they have
agreed to purchase hereunder on such date and the aggregate number of Firm
Shares or Additional Shares, as the case may be, which such defaulting
Underwriter or Underwriters agreed but failed or refused to purchase is not more
than one-tenth of the total number of Firm Shares or Additional Shares, as the
case may be, to be purchased on such date by all Underwriters, each
non-defaulting Underwriter shall be obligated severally, in the proportion which
the number of Firm Shares set forth opposite its name in Schedule I bears to the
total number of Firm Shares

                                          27
<PAGE>

which all the non-defaulting Underwriters have agreed to purchase, or in such
other proportion as you may specify, to purchase the Firm Shares or Additional
Shares, as the case may be, which such defaulting Underwriter or Underwriters
agreed but failed or refused to purchase on such date; PROVIDED that in no event
shall the number of Firm Shares or Additional Shares, as the case may be, which
any Underwriter has agreed to purchase pursuant to Section 2 hereof be increased
pursuant to this Section 10 by an amount in excess of one-ninth of such number
of Firm Shares or Additional Shares, as the case may be, without the written
consent of such Underwriter.  If on the Closing Date any Underwriter or
Underwriters shall fail or refuse to purchase Firm Shares and the aggregate
number of Firm Shares with respect to which such default occurs is more than
one-tenth of the aggregate number of Firm Shares to be purchased  by all
Underwriters and arrangements satisfactory to you and the Company for purchase
of such Firm Shares are not made within 48 hours after such default, this
Agreement will terminate without liability on the part of any non-defaulting
Underwriter and the Company.   In any such case which does not result in
termination of this Agreement, either you or the Company shall have the right to
postpone the Closing Date, but in no event for longer than seven days, in order
that the required changes, if any, in the Registration Statement and the
Prospectus or any other documents or arrangements may be effected. If, on an
Option Closing Date, any Underwriter or Underwriters shall fail or refuse to
purchase Additional  Shares and the aggregate number of Additional Shares with
respect to which such default occurs is more than one-tenth of the aggregate
number of Additional Shares to be purchased on such date, the non-defaulting
Underwriters shall have the option to (i) terminate their obligation hereunder
to purchase such Additional Shares or (ii) purchase not less than the number of
Additional Shares that such non-defaulting Underwriters would have been
obligated to purchase on such date in the absence of such default.  Any action
taken under this paragraph shall not relieve any defaulting Underwriter from
liability in respect of any default of any such Underwriter under this
Agreement.
